Ella Deloria, the bilingual and bicultural Lakota ethnologist and linguist, wrote hundreds of traditional narratives, autobiographies, anecdotes, and reminiscences in both Lakota and English during the 1920s and 1930s. Iron Hawk represents the culmination of Deloria's colloquial style of synthesizing from memory rather than transcribing from tape or written notes. A young aristocratic woman is wrongfully arrested for a crime and sent to America on a convict ship, where she is sold as an indentured servant to a ship builder, a widower with a two-year-old son. They eventually marry, but the unexpected arrival of their families from England complicate their marriage and force them to confront an adversary from the woman's past.

Fanny Howe's poetry is known for its lyricism, fragmentation, experimentation, religious engagement, and commitment to social justice. In Second Childhood, the observing poet is an impersonal figure who accompanies Howe in her encounters with chance and mystery. She is not one age or the other, in one time or another.
